PARALLEL COMPUTATION STRUCTURE FOR 2-D MULTIDOMAIN PROBLEMS OF HEAT CONDUCTION WITH D CODES ON DISTRIBUTED-MEMORY MP-3 MULTIPROCESSORS
V.I. Delov, L.V. Dmitrieva, D.M. Linnik, R.Z. Samigullina VANT. Ser.: Mat. Mod. Fiz. Proc 1999. Вып.1. С. 21-25.
Parallelization algorithm is studied for 2-D multidomain heat conduction computations on distributed-memory multiprocessors. The algorithm under consideration is implemented with D codes intended for numerical calculations of 2-D and 3-D gas dynamics, heat conduction and elasticity-plasticity in Lagrangian variables on regular grids. The results of parallelization algo-rithm evaluation on 8-processor MP-3 system are presented.
